protect Pheripheral with MPU

キャンセル
次の結果を表示 
表示  限定  | 次の代わりに検索 
もしかして: 

protect Pheripheral with MPU

683件の閲覧回数
Yellen
Contributor II

Hi,

Can MPU protect registers of Pheripherals? 

If the answer is yes, which MPU slave port does the pheriheral belong?

Snipaste_2023-06-13_17-38-20.png

タグ(2)
0 件の賞賛
返信
5 返答(返信)

673件の閲覧回数
Robin_Shen
NXP TechSupport
NXP TechSupport

Hi Yellen,

Please read Chapter 16 Peripheral Bridge (AIPS-Lite) of S32K1xx MCU Family - Reference Manual

And you can refer to:
How to use s32k144 aips?
aips_demo_s32k118.zip


Best Regards,
Robin
-------------------------------------------------------------------------------
Note:
- If this post answers your question, please click the "Mark Correct" button. Thank you!

- We are following threads for 7 weeks after the last post, later replies are ignored
Please open a new thread and refer to the closed one, if you have a related question at a later point in time.
-------------------------------------------------------------------------------

0 件の賞賛
返信

662件の閲覧回数
Yellen
Contributor II

Hi Robin,

Thanks for your response.

Refer to the Chapter 16, the MPU will not cover peripheral access protection. The pheriherals are protected by AIPS. Right?

But how to understand the MPU register can be protected by MPU as said below?

Snipaste_2023-06-13_17-38-20.png

0 件の賞賛
返信

633件の閲覧回数
Robin_Shen
NXP TechSupport
NXP TechSupport

14.1.2 Crossbar Switch slave assignments The following table identifies the slaves connected to the Crossbar Switch and whether the system MPU protects them.
System MPU does not protect access to peripheral registers, including system MPU's own registers. Protection is built into Peripheral Bridge (AIPS-Lite).

System MPU does not protect access to peripheral registers, including system MPU's own registers.jpg

I also can't understand: If the MPU registers are protected by the MPU

0 件の賞賛
返信

621件の閲覧回数
Yellen
Contributor II

Suppose the MPU's register address is included in one region descriptor, will MPU report error if illegal access to MPU's register occured?

0 件の賞賛
返信

540件の閲覧回数
Robin_Shen
NXP TechSupport
NXP TechSupport

I don't think so, but you can test it out.

0 件の賞賛
返信